Ich habe beim Scripten von einem Stats GUI einen Fehler gemacht *-*
Ich habe nicht alles unter eine Funktion genommen (local) damit sich diese Aktualisiert beim StatsGUI sondern habe alles
ohne nachzudenken schon in die "guiCreateLabel" schon über "getElementData" rein gescriptet
Kein Wunder also das sich diese nur beim Restart Aktualisiert
Also gebe es eine Möglichkeit anstatt es zu erneuern das sich das GUI trotzdem beim Starten Aktualisiert??
Das was ich hier hin Kopiere ist ja nicht alles sonst würde ich das sofort umscripten
SQL
Stats_GUI = {}
Stats_Button = {}
--------------------------------------
Stats_GUI = guiCreateWindow(0.2,0.2,0.6,0.7,"Stats ["..getPlayerName(getLocalPlayer()).."]",true)
guiSetAlpha(Stats_GUI,true)
guiSetAlpha(Reallife,false)
guiSetAlpha(Scheinse ,false)
guiSetAlpha(Sonst ,false)
guiSetVisible(Stats_GUI,false)
Reallife = guiCreateLabel(10,30,91,16,"Reallife Daten",false,Stats_GUI)
--------------------------------------------------------------------------------------------------
email_stats = guiCreateLabel(10,80,91,16,"E-Mail:",false,Stats_GUI)
email_name = guiCreateLabel(120,80,120,16,""..getElementData ( getLocalPlayer(), "EMail" ).."",false,Stats_GUI)
guiLabelSetColor(email_name,200,200,200 )
guiLabelSetVerticalAlign(email_name,"top")
guiLabelSetHorizontalAlign(email_name,"right",false)
guiLabelSetColor(email_stats,200,200,200)
Alles anzeigen
Server Side!